High temp sticky tape?

I am replacing my moho's incandescent bulbs with LEDs. I found this deal on ebay

8 White T10 BA9S 48 LED SMD Dome Panel Lamp Light Bulb | eBay

They end up being less than $4 each and give off more light than the ones I removed. The only problem is the double-sided tape gives up when the LEDs warm up.

Anyone have any ideas on a fix?
